Exploring the Effects of Gravity

Gravity is another fascinating topic to explore in a science project. This can be done by exploring the effects of gravity on different objects. For example, a science project could involve dropping a ball from different heights and measuring the time it takes for it to hit the ground. This is a great project for teaching children about the effects of gravity and how it affects different objects.
